The rising health awareness among the global population has had a major influence on the demand for functional food ingredients. The global market is witnessing the development of a wide range of applications of functional food ingredients, such as fortifying food & beverage products.

Functional Food Ingredients Market is expected to generate a revenue of USD 137.1 billion by 2026, at a CAGR of 6.8%. The global industry size was valued at USD 98.9 billion in 2021. The functional food ingredients market refers to the market for ingredients that have health benefits beyond basic nutrition. These ingredients can include probiotics, prebiotics, vitamins, minerals, and other nutrients. The market for functional food ingredients has been growing in recent years as consumers become more interested in maintaining and improving their health through their diets. Factors driving the market include an aging population, increasing awareness of the link between diet and health, and growing demand for convenient, functional food products. The market is also driven by the increasing trend of functional food being used as a preventive measure for chronic diseases. The market for functional food ingredients is expected to continue growing in the coming years, driven by factors such as increasing demand for functional food products, a growing global population, and increasing awareness of the health benefits of functional food ingredients.

The inclination toward nutritional and convenience food and the rise in demand for fortified food & beverage products are expected to drive the growth of the market during the forecast period. However, factors such as adherence to the international quality standards & regulations and lack of awareness about functional ingredients such as prebiotics and probiotics in developing countries act as restraints to the growth of the market.

Prebiotics and probiotics are the emerging functional food ingredient segments in which researchers are focusing on developing different applications and benefits. Nutrigenomics or personalized nutrition is a specialized diet in which food scientists seek to treat chronic health conditions such as cardiovascular disease, obesity, Alzheimer’s disease, and diabetes using specific functional food ingredients. It is an emerging concept in the functional food ingredients market, and leading food manufacturers such as Cargill (US), Archer Daniels Midland Company (US), and Koninklijke DSM N.V. (Netherlands) are investing substantially in R&D. The most common emerging technologies in the functional food ingredients industry are high-hydrostatic pressure, ultrasound-assisted and microwave-assisted extraction, pulsed electric field, radio-frequency drying, high voltage electrical discharge, and supercritical fluids. Other emerging technologies still under development include cold plasma treatment, electro-osmotic dewatering, and nanoencapsulation.

Veganism has shown remarkable growth over the last couple of years. It is further projected to increase, and consumer demand is projected to shift to plant-based functional food ingredients for meat and dairy products. The current outbreak of COVID-19 and negative associations with animal-based foods will further shift the consumers to plant-based ingredients. Since a large number of protein ingredients have entered the market for food products, it is further projected to increase. Due to COVID-19, sustainability, low-carbon footprint, and positive health effects offered by plant-based ingredients such as pea protein, pea starch, antioxidants from Brussel sprouts, polyphenols from fig and omega-3, and other functional ingredients from hemp will enable plant-based ingredients to take further precedence over animal-based food. This will further drive revenues and investments in plant-sourced functional food ingredients.

The North American market accounted for the largest share in 2020. This market is projected to be driven by the increase in consumer demand for healthy convenience food due to their busy lifestyles. Further, increasing occurrences of obesity and cardiac diseases have led consumers to demand functional food products, thereby driving the market for functional food ingredients. The South American market is projected to grow at the highest CAGR from 2021 to 2026. The growing food processing industry in the region, along with the growing health consciousness, has a direct impact on the functional food ingredients industry in the region owing to the use of functional food ingredients in energy drinks & bars, dairy products, and infant-fortified food. This is the key reason for the high growth rates of all types of functional food ingredients in this region.
